It is the latest version, but with some errors. The Philippine OOB I released also has some issues heh, but I would suggest downloading that and converting it to Country 83 and using it instead. The standalone Philippine OOB will be included for Country 83 in all subsequent releases.

It has a specific picklist for actions against the VC and NVA which should make it more historically accurate if people choose to fight against it for the period of the deployment of the Philippine Civic Action Group-Vietnam (PHILCAG-V) which is 4/66-12/69.

The Lao OOB also has to be correct and that will probably include a new picklist set, that's on the major to do list.

The Total Conversion Pack is very different. The most immediately obvious change will be seen in the USA and USMC OOBs, with all USAF aircraft removed from both, and all USN aircraft removed from the USMC OOB. USAF aircraft were moved to OOB 80 (which is now the USAF) and USN aircraft to OOB 6 (which is now the USN). You'll have to use the allies tab to get to these units. What this does mean is that both are greatly expanded. The USAF OOB also has SAR units, Combat Security Police, Combat Control Teams, and other things included, and the USN OOB has a far wider array of boats plus the Sea Wolves of HA(L)-7.

All changes are included in the Readme file, with notes and explanations. Countries and what they are now are included, and I'm working on getting flags up so that this is reflected on the purchase screens and in game.

If you are looking for scenario development involving the Philippine Army you are restricted historically from 4/66-12/69, US forces from ~1963-2/73 and ARVN until 4/75. Laos runs to 5/75.

In the other pack you'll find the rest of the updated OOBs. I'd have the check the dates on South Korea and Australia (though I think that with the Aussies you could go by the "VN" labeled formation dates). The Thai and Cambodian OOBs are just updated, and follow basically the ARVN timeline. Cambodia falls to the Khmer Rouge around the same time (by 4/75 the situation is pretty dire).

For the purposes of this pack, I would recommend backing up your graphics, text, picklist, and leader folders. Put the OOB folder into your custom OOB folder in the WinSPMBT directory and use the OOB manager in the game swap them in. The OOB manager can also be used to replace the default OOBs, so you don't have to back those up.

So basically, if you're looking to do scenarios I would install the basic Vietnam Specific OOB Pack, then this pack over it (because it replaces the ARVN OOB, and the USA and USMC OOB found in pre-V4 Vietnam Specific packs). Then go from there. If you don't plan on using Cambodia, Thailand, South Korea, or Australia, you could also probably stick to just this pack.
